Output 77f603b6f0257835c8e1641c5c5f4518a0e7f2cd269cbe11f39eeeb3b8e533c9:18

value
109478013
script pubkey
OP_0 OP_PUSHBYTES_32 cd9750e4ebc382cebfa922dff4adc7140f260fac682e4c01be4b5f8c6d2996b2
address
bc1qekt4pe8tcwpva0afyt0lftw8zs8jvravdqhycqd7fd0ccmffj6eqwydyew
transaction
77f603b6f0257835c8e1641c5c5f4518a0e7f2cd269cbe11f39eeeb3b8e533c9
spent
true